Bulgaria has a population of 6.44M (ranked 110/197), compared with 1.4M in East Timor (ranked 152/197). Bulgaria's land area is 41,915 sq mi versus 5,741 sq mi for East Timor (ranked 101st vs. 155th).
By GDP, Bulgaria ranks 68/197 ($112B) and East Timor ranks 180/197 ($1.88B). By GDP per capita, Bulgaria ranks 64/197 ($17,412), while East Timor ranks 166/197 ($1,343).
